Having Just Plein Fun on Balboa Island
At the 20th annual “Just Plein Fun” event hosted by the Huse Skelly Gallery on Balboa Island (July 28 – August 1, 2025), 11 award-winning artists from across the country created close to 100 new paintings of the local area. The culmination was Friday’s “Brush Off” competition on Marine Avenue and the Awards Gala and Reception.
